Level 1 Food and Nutrition

Subject Description

Teacher in Charge: Mrs A. Schwass.

This course combines health and wellbeing with NUTRITION and practical hands on cooking that reflects learning.

We begin with a Unit Standard on fruit and vegetables and flow onto teenage nutritional needs that leads to long term well-being for life. This involves a further three Achievement standards for those who value endorsements.

This is a fantastic course for our ACTIVE TEENAGERS.

NB: Level 1 Food and Nutrition and Level 1 Health cover the same Achievement Standards. If you want to do both courses then you must consider that you will only be able to gain a maximum of 20 credits across the two courses (Achievement Standard Credits). No matter what course you choose, you will have entry into both Level 2 Food and Nutrition and Health.

Recommended Prior Learning

Completing the Food and Nutrition course at Year 10 is recommended as it provides the students with the necessary basic knowledge and terminology related to food, diet, and nutrition. However, Year 10 Health is also prerequisite for this course as it begins the development of a holistic understanding of health-related concepts. This gives students a good head start.
